Output 36623ff79e43cb9531cb5fbfe36894d17ebbfa86d603e3bb65e700eaf69480e8:0

value
89511830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201f1f8b05625f4545ba1b3a4426e7c4b0ddda14 OP_EQUAL
address
34crqAJbTXDx3E4JGJDA7r7YtdFJpePV6e
transaction
36623ff79e43cb9531cb5fbfe36894d17ebbfa86d603e3bb65e700eaf69480e8
spent
true